Throughout Bulgaria at a variety of occasions, festive, religious, or social, the people will gather to join in their national Horo, a gay dance with countless variations of music and step, in a circular or chain formation for any number of dancers. The dancing of Horos is enjoyed by everyone, from the soldiers in barracks to the workers in harvest fields, and in days gone by many trades had their own version of the dance. Then there are the Sheep's Dance, 'Violet, Little Violet' and the Rachenitsa, with its accompanying song.

In this book, illustrated by four colour plates, are detailed descriptions of four typical peasant dances with the correct dance steps and music.

Mme Raina Katsarova was head of the Folk Dance and Music department of the Ethnographical Museum in Sofia; and herself collected more than 6,000 Bulgarian folk songs and 200 dances.
